Brown Co Fair begins Saturday
07/03/2023

(KNZA)--The 106th annual Brown County Free Fair will kick off Saturday and runs through Friday, July 14 at the fairgrounds in Horton

The theme of this year's Fair is “ Handmade, Homegrown, and Country Sown!”

On Saturday, the county's 4-H clubs will rotate on a schedule to drop off their projects at the Blue Building, beginning at 8:00 in the morning.

On Sunday, the horse and pet shows will take place. Monday will feature the livestock entries as well as the Brown County Shooting Sports Show at 12 noon. The public fashion revue and food auction will be held Monday evening beginning at 6:00 at the Blue Building.

Tuesday will bring the fair parade at 6:30 in the evening in downtown Horton. Following the parade, free entertainment will be provided by Curtis Stroud and the pedal power tractor pull will be held.

Wednesday will feature the swine, bucket calf, beef and dairy shows.

Bounce houses and a mechanical bull will be available for entertainment Wednesday and Thursday evening's. Also Thursday evening there will be a rock wall and corn hole tournament. In addition, Callous Maddy/Traffas will be providing free entertainment Thursday evening at 8:00.

The Fair will wrap up Friday evening, July 14 with the awards program and livestock sale.
